  • Codependency

    Individuals with codependency might find themselves in “one-sided” relationships where one person needs the other, and in turn, the other who needs to be needed. Codependent relationships can be emotionally destructive, isolating, and/or abusive. Codependency stems from learned patterns in childhood by our caregivers. Therapy can help people with codependency recognize their patterns, identify their needs, implement boundaries, and develop a healthier sense of self.

    Borderline Personality Disorder

    Borderline Personality Disorder (BPD) is a mental health condition characterized by intense emotions, unstable relationships, difficulties with self-image, and impulsive behaviors. People with BPD may experience rapid mood changes, fear of abandonment, and struggles with regulating emotions, which can feel overwhelming but are treatable with therapy and support. I approach treatment to BPD through a compassionate lens, offering skills and tools for self-regulation.
